
Choose or find the odd number pair. (23-29), (19-25), (13-17), (3-5).
A. 23 - 29
B. 19 - 25
C. 13 - 17
D. 3 - 5

Complete step-by-step solution:
According to the question it is asked of us to find the pair of an odd number from (23 - 29), (19 - 25), (13 - 17), (3 - 5). So, if we want to solve this problem, then in the given problem first we will find the odd number pairs and then we will check if there prime numbers in the pair or not available any prime numbers in the pair. If both numbers of a pair are prime numbers, then we will leave that pair and we check the next pair with the same condition. And finally we will get the answer.
So, if we see the pair (23 - 29). Then here both 23 and 29 are the prime numbers.
If we check the pair (19 - 25), then 19 is the prime number but 25 is only an odd number, that is not prime.
If we check the pair (13 - 17), here both are prime numbers.
And if we check (3 - 5), then both 3 and 5 are prime numbers.
So, the correct option is B.
